The newer OSTC+ (2026 and later) and OSTC Nano models require a Bluetooth Low Energy (BLE)-compatible updater to update the firmware. While the OSTConf iOS app or the latest HWOS Config for Android (to be released shortly) can perform this task on your mobile device, the old OSTC Companion is unable to do so on desktop computers. We recommend updating via Subsurface here: https://subsurface-divelog.org/
Here is a step-by-step manual how to do it:
- Pair OSTC with your System from the system's Bluetooth settings (Optional but this makes pairing with Subsurface quicker - at least with Windows 11)
- Download and unzip the firmware file from https://hwdiving.com/firmwares/
Step 1: Select "Change settings on dive computer" from the Menu
Step 2: Select OSTC 2/3Plus from the list and click on "Select Bluetooth Device"
Step 3: Click "Scan" and select the OSTC from the list. Click "Save"
Step 4: Wait until "Connected to device" is shown at the bottom, click "Update Firmware". Select the update file (.HEX file) from your PC
Step 5: Wait. The Update via BLE will take ~60 seconds. The OSTC will reboot into the new firmware automatically.
